This subcontract for the Department of Defense involves the supply and installation of a 12-lane wireless, self-propelled target retrieval system at a Hawaii Air National Guard facility. The scope of work includes the removal of existing systems and the installation of 12 wireless target carriers featuring 360-degree rotation, contactless charging assemblies, and a centralized master range-control system. To ensure compliance with UFC 4-179-02, all cabling must be protected using AR500 ballistic deflection shielding. The project is designated as a total Small Business Set Aside under NAICS code 333310. Performance will take place in Hawaii, zip code 96853. The solicitation was posted on September 18, 2026, with a response deadline of September 28, 2026. The final deliverable is a fully operational 12-lane target retrieval system provided to prime contractors.

Amendment P0002: Pacific Floor Care-Floor Scrubbers/Vacuum COMBINED SYNOPSIS/SOLICITATION–FAR 19.502-2(a) SB SET-ASIDE -BRAND NAME-OEM LOA Required w/ Quote
Solicitation # 36C24126Q0821
The Department of Veterans Affairs, through the Network Contracting Office 01, has issued a combined synopsis and solicitation for the procurement of industrial-grade Pacific Floor Care equipment to support the Manchester VA Medical Center. This requirement is a Total Small Business Set-Aside under NAICS code 333310, specifically targeting SBA-verified small businesses. The procurement includes two 28-inch Pacific disk scrubbers with lead-acid battery shields, two QS-12 walk-behind scrubbers, and eight V15ED upright dual-motor vacuums, along with all necessary accessories such as chargers, hoses, and safety labels. The estimated total value for this acquisition is $39,761.34. The contract is a brand-name procurement where no substitutions are permitted, and award will be made to the responsible, OEM-authorized small business offering the lowest evaluated price. Offerors must provide a Letter of Authorization from the Original Equipment Manufacturer to verify their status as an authorized distributor. Equipment must adhere to strict safety and operational standards, including OSHA machine safety, EPA Clean Water Act wastewater handling, and VA infection-control protocols, while maintaining noise levels below 70 dB for patient-care environments. Following an award, the contractor is responsible for delivery within 30 days, installation and training within 45 days, and completing inspection and acceptance within 50 days. An amendment has extended the response deadline to September 21, 2026, at 11:00 AM EDT.

Supply and Delivery of Autonomous Floor Scrubber
Solicitation # RFP-33-2026
The Town of Whitby has issued solicitation RFP-33-2026 for the supply, delivery, implementation, commissioning, training, maintenance, and support of two autonomous floor scrubber solutions. These units will be deployed at the Iroquois Sports Centre and the McKinney Centre to maintain municipal recreation facilities, including arenas and community centres. The required solution must include the scrubber hardware, battery charging systems, and a software platform for mapping, navigation, and analytics. The equipment must be capable of operating safely in high-traffic public environments across various floor surfaces and must comply with all applicable Canadian safety, electrical, and occupational health standards. The procurement process follows a multi-step evaluation totaling 140 points, consisting of pass/fail business requirements, a technical bid (90 points), a financial bid (20 points), and demonstrations (30 points). The contract will be awarded to the bidder with the highest total score, provided they meet the minimum technical and demonstration thresholds. Bids must be submitted in PDF format via the online bidding system by October 15, 2026. Selected vendors must provide proof of insurance naming the Town as an additional insured and deliver a WSIB clearance certificate as a condition of the contract. Payment is based on the Town's acceptance of deliverables, and the vendor is required to provide transition support upon the expiration or termination of the agreement.

Solicitation for Hazardous Materials Survey Services
Solicitation # W50SLF26QA024
The Hawaii Air National Guard requires a contractor to conduct a targeted hazardous materials survey at Building 3400, floor 3, located at the Hawaii Air National Guard Campus, JBPHH, Hickam AFB. The scope of work involves testing for lead-based paint, asbestos, pol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s), mercury, mold, and heavy metals. All analytical testing must be performed by a DoD ELAP or NELAP certified laboratory, and the contractor must utilize industrial health sampling methods. The project is a firm fixed price award with a performance period of 10 work days from the date of award receipt, with services performed Monday through Friday between 0700 and 1600. This procurement is a total small business set-aside. To be eligible for award, offerors must provide a signed price quotation, a completed work experience form detailing relevant projects from the last three years, and evidence of valid State of Hawaii inspector certifications. Evaluation is based on a combination of price, technical capability, and work experience, with the latter two being considered equal to price. Quotes are due by 11:00 AM HST on September 23, 2026, and must be submitted electronically to the designated point of contact. Award will be made to the responsible offeror whose proposal is most advantageous to the government without further discussions.

Munitions Maintenance and Inspection (M&I) Facility & Conventional Munitions Cube Storage Addition, HIANG, JBPHH, HI
Solicitation # W50SLF-26-R-A005
The Hawaii National Guard intends to award a single firm-fixed-price contract to a small business for two construction projects located at the Hawaii Air National Guard campus on Joint Base Pearl Harbor-Hickam, Hawaii. The first project, the Munitions Maintenance and Inspection Facility, is an estimated 2,400 square foot construction involving micro-pile foundations, cast-in-place concrete, structural steel framing, and specialized HVAC and fire protection systems. This project includes an option for a Material Assembly Center concrete pad and asphalt pavement. The second project is a 1,320 square foot Conventional Munitions Cube Storage Addition designed to support the F-22 mission, featuring high-hazard storage specifications, micro-pile foundations, and integrated fire detection systems. Both projects are subject to a $14 million statutory cost limitation for Unspecified Minor Military Construction. The total magnitude of construction is estimated between $10,000,000 and $25,000,000, with the maintenance facility project exceeding $10,000,000 and the storage addition falling between $1,000,000 and $5,000,000. The maintenance facility has a projected duration of 733 calendar days, while the storage addition is expected to take 456 calendar days. This solicitation is a 100% small business set-aside under NAICS code 236220, and contractors must comply with limitations on subcontracting, ensuring no more than 85 percent of the contract amount (excluding materials) is paid to non-similarly situated subcontractors. Proposals must be submitted through the Procurement Integrated Enterprise Environment (PIEE) platform by a tentative closing date of October 27, 2026. Evaluation will be based on technical capability, past performance, and price, with the government intending to award without conducting discussions.

SVC Cable TV & Internet Services HIANG FY26-FY31
Solicitation # W50SLF26QA001700001
The Hawaii Army National Guard is soliciting quotes for commercial cable TV and internet services delivered via Wi-Fi for designated buildings at Hickam AFB and various Geographically Separated Units throughout the islands of Hawaii. The contractor must provide services using contractor-owned cables and is strictly prohibited from mounting satellite dishes on any buildings. The contract is structured with a 12-month base period and four 12-month option years, spanning a total period of performance from September 30, 2026, to September 29, 2031. Under NAICS code 517111, the government will award the contract to the responsible offeror deemed most advantageous based on technical capabilities and price. Quotations must be submitted by 10:00 AM HST on September 25, 2026, and should not exceed five pages. Required submission documents include a signed SF1449, a signed SF30 amendment, evidence of technical capabilities, and comprehensive vendor identification and socio-economic status. All respondents must have completed representations and certifications in the System for Award Management. The contractor is responsible for providing its own private insurance and ensuring all technicians hold current industry certifications. Performance will be monitored via a Quality Assurance Surveillance Plan, with a requirement that services meet standards 100 percent of the time. Invoicing must be processed monthly through the Wide Area Workflow system. The government intends to award the contract without discussions, meaning initial offers should reflect the vendor's best possible terms.
